When you are looking at wood fireplaces, the final cost dep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a pre-fabricated insert and a custom masonry build is the biggest factor. You also have to think about venting requirements, the type of chimney lining needed, and the finish materials like stone or brick veneer. If your home needs structural modifications to meet current safety codes, that will add to the labor hours. We look at your specific setup to provide a clear path forward. EPA-certified wood stoves and fireplace inserts are generally the most efficient. These units are designed to burn wood more completely, maximizing heat output and minimizing emissions. Pros can recommend suitable models for Sacramento homes.

A wood fireplace can effectively heat the room it's in and nearby areas. For whole-house heating, it typically serves as a supplemental heat source. Modern wood-burning inserts are much more efficient at distributing heat throughout your Sacramento home.
Yes, inserts are a great investment for upgrading existing fireplaces. They convert open hearths into more efficient heating appliances, saving wood and providing more warmth. It's a practical enhancement for many Sacramento residences.
